Re: Can I wear this to a wedding?

ITA, too casual.

Since you are worried about your arms and stomach, can you find a regular dress, doesn't matter if sleeveless, that you find covers your stomach? Then find a lacey cardigan or something and put it over the dress. That always looks dressy enough. Or try a wrap dress with sleeves - black, and you can dress it up with a nice necklace, shoes and purse. Wrap dresses tend to look a little dressier but are very comfortable.
